Check Digit Verification of cas no
The CAS Registry Mumber 21323-37-5 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,1,3,2 and 3 respectively; the second part has 2 digits, 3 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 21323-37:
(7*2)+(6*1)+(5*3)+(4*2)+(3*3)+(2*3)+(1*7)=65
65 % 10 = 5
So 21323-37-5 is a valid CAS Registry Number.
